The Sonoma State men’s basketball team will visit the University of Arizona in an exhibition game on Nov. 12, marking the third time the programs have met in an exhibition game in Tucson since 2004. The Seawolves, who will be paid $25,000 for making the trip, lost to the Wildcats 102-63 in 2005 and 105-80 in 2004. Sonoma State senior second baseman David Adler has been named a first-team All-American by the Jewish Sports Review, a bi-monthly publication that highlights Jewish athletes. Adler hit .337 with eight steals and was named the Division II Defensive Player of the Year after not committing an error in 219 chances. Twenty-four hours after a disappointing performance in the 1,500 meters at the U.S. Olympic Track and Field Trials, Santa Rosa’s Sara Hall was moving on. To Europe. Hall, 25, a four-time state cross-country champion at Montgomery High, left for Amsterdam on Monday afternoon and will race in the area — possibly competing in Spain and Belgium — until late July.
